Similar presentations:
Standartizaciya-i-licenzirovanie-programmnyh-produktov (1)
1.
Стандартизация илицензирование
программных продуктов
Комплексное руководство по стандартам качества и моделям
лицензирования в индустрии программного обеспечения
2.
Введение в стандартизацию ПО: основные понятия и целиЧто такое стандартизация?
Ключевые цели
Стандартизация программного обеспечения — это процесс
Повышение качества и надежности программных продуктов
Обеспечение совместимости между различными системами
Снижение затрат на разработку и поддержку
Защита интересов пользователей и разработчиков
установления единых норм, правил и требований к разработке,
тестированию и эксплуатации ПО. Она обеспечивает качество,
совместимость и безопасность программных продуктов.
Качество
Совместимость
Безопасность
Гарантия соответствия установленным
Взаимодействие между различными
Защита данных и устойчивость к
требованиям
системами
угрозам
3.
Международные и национальные стандартыдля программного обеспечения
ISO/IEC 25010
1
Определяет модель качества программного обеспечения, включая функциональность,
производительность, совместимость, удобство использования, надежность, безопасность,
сопровождаемость и переносимость.
ISO/IEC 12207
2
Устанавливает процессы жизненного цикла программного обеспечения — от концепции и
разработки до внедрения, эксплуатации и вывода из эксплуатации.
ГОСТ Р ИСО/МЭК
3
Национальные стандарты Российской Федерации, адаптирующие международные
требования к специфике отечественного рынка и законодательства.
IEEE Standards
4
Стандарты Института инженеров электротехники и электроники, охватывающие
проектирование, тестирование, документирование и управление проектами.
4.
Процессы сертификации и соответствия стандартам качестваАудит и тестирование
Подготовка документации
Проведение комплексного анализа кода, функционального и нагрузочного
Формирование полного пакета технической документации, описания
тестирования, проверка на соответствие заявленным стандартам
архитектуры, функциональных требований и спецификаций программного
качества.
продукта.
Поддержка соответствия
Получение сертификата
Официальное подтверждение соответствия продукта установленным
Регулярный мониторинг, обновление документации, повторная
сертификация при значительных изменениях продукта или стандартов.
стандартам, выдача сертификата аккредитованным органом
сертификации.
Важно: Сертификация — это не разовое событие, а непрерывный процесс поддержания соответствия стандартам на протяжении всего жизненного
цикла продукта.
5.
Обзор основных типов лицензий на программное обеспечениеЛицензия на программное обеспечение — это юридический договор между правообладателем и
пользователем, определяющий условия использования, распространения и модификации программного
продукта.
Проприетарные
Открытые
Закрытый исходный код, строгие ограничения на использование и распространение,
Открытый исходный код, свобода использования, изменения и распространения с
полный контроль разработчика.
различными уровнями ограничений.
Коммерческие
Freemium
Платное использование, различные модели монетизации, техническая поддержка и
Базовая версия бесплатна, расширенные функции доступны по подписке или за
гарантии от разработчика.
единовременную плату.
6.
Проприетарные лицензии: особенности иограничения
Закрытый исходный код
Ограничения использования
Пользователи не имеют доступа к исходному
Строгие условия: запрет на декомпиляцию,
коду программы и не могут его изучать,
реверс-инжиниринг, ограничения по
модифицировать или распространять. Все
количеству установок, привязка к конкретному
права принадлежат правообладателю.
устройству или организации.
Техническая поддержка
Разработчик обычно предоставляет
официальную поддержку, регулярные
обновления безопасности и исправления
ошибок в рамках лицензионного соглашения.
Преимущества
Недостатки
Профессиональная техподдержка
Высокая стоимость
Гарантии качества и безопасности
Зависимость от поставщика
Регулярные обновления
Отсутствие гибкости настройки
7.
Открытые лицензии: GNU GPL, MIT, Apache и другиеGNU GPL
MIT License
Apache 2.0
General Public License — копилефт-
Одна из самых permissive лицензий.
Permissive лицензия с явным
лицензия, требующая распространения
Минимальные ограничения: разрешено
предоставлением патентных прав.
производных работ под той же
практически все, включая коммерческое
Защищает от патентных исков, требует
лицензией. Гарантирует свободу
использование. Требуется только
указания изменений и сохранения
использования, изучения,
сохранение уведомления об авторских
уведомлений.
распространения и модификации.
правах.
BSD License
Mozilla Public License
Семейство permissive лицензий с минимальными
Гибридная лицензия, сочетающая элементы копилефта
требованиями, популярны в академической среде и
и permissive подходов, позволяет комбинировать с
корпоративных проектах.
проприетарным кодом.
8.
Коммерческое лицензирование: модели распространения имонетизации
Perpetual License
Единовременная покупка с бессрочным
правом использования. Обновления и
поддержка могут оплачиваться отдельно.
Freemium
Базовая версия бесплатна, премиум-
Subscription
Модель подписки с регулярными платежами
(месяц, год). Включает обновления,
поддержку и облачные сервисы.
Per-User Licensing
Лицензирование по количеству
функции платные. Позволяет привлечь
пользователей или устройств. Гибкое
широкую аудиторию и конвертировать в
масштабирование для организаций разного
платных клиентов.
размера.
Тренд: Большинство компаний переходят от perpetual лицензий к subscription-моделям, обеспечивающим стабильный денежный поток и
постоянное взаимодействие с клиентами.
9.
Правовые аспекты и защита интеллектуальной собственностиОсновные инструменты защиты
Интеллектуальная собственность в сфере ПО защищается комплексом правовых механизмов, включая авторское право,
патенты, товарные знаки и коммерческую тайну.
01
02
Авторское право
Патентная защита
Автоматически возникает при создании программы, защищает код, документацию, интерфейсы. Действует в
Защищает алгоритмы и технические решения (в странах, где это разрешено). Требует регистрации, действует 20
течение жизни автора плюс 70 лет в большинстве юрисдикций.
лет, дает исключительное право на использование.
03
04
Товарные знаки
Договорные отношения
Защищают название продукта, логотип, брендинг. Требуют регистрации, могут продлеваться неограниченно,
Лицензионные соглашения, NDA, контракты с сотрудниками определяют права и обязанности сторон, механизмы
предотвращают недобросовестную конкуренцию.
разрешения споров и ответственность за нарушения.
Эффективная защита интеллектуальной собственности требует комбинации технических, организационных и правовых мер на всех этапах жизненного цикла продукта.
10.
Выводы и рекомендации по выборустандартов и лицензий
Для выбора стандартов
Определите целевую аудиторию и требования рынка
Оцените необходимость международной сертификации
Учитывайте отраслевую специфику и регуляторные требования
Планируйте бюджет на процессы сертификации и поддержку соответствия
Для выбора лицензий
Определите бизнес-модель и стратегию монетизации
Оцените баланс между открытостью и контролем
Учитывайте совместимость с зависимостями проекта
Проконсультируйтесь с юристами по ИС
Качество
Гибкость
Защита
Стандарты обеспечивают высокое
Правильная лицензия соответствует
Комплексный подход к защите ИС
качество и доверие клиентов
целям проекта
критически важен